    For titles/plates/reg, yeah, I would say go to a third party.

    However, photo retakes and licence renewals or replacements all have to be done at the MVD or an authorized third party (not all), as technically you are subject to a new Vision Exam every time your photo is replaced. Or every 12 years, whichever comes first.

    E: I did some research on this though, apparently there are a TON of third party locations that can process a DL renewal, whoda thunk it.
